Introduction
Aluminium / aluminum 2319 alloy is a heat treatable wrought alloy that possesses excellent resistance to stress corrosion cracking. It is a filler alloy that was developed for use with aluminium / aluminum 2219 alloy.
Aluminium / aluminum 2319 alloy provides higher strength and better ductility than aluminium / aluminum 4xxx filler alloys when welding aluminium / aluminum 2xxx alloys. It should not be used for welding aluminium / aluminum 5xxx series alloys.

Chemical Composition
The following table shows the chemical composition of aluminium / aluminum 2319 alloy.
Element |
Content (%) |
Aluminum, Al |
93 |
Copper, Cu |
6.3 |
Manganese, Mn |
0.3 |
Zinc, Zn |
0.18 |
Titanium, Ti |
0.15 |
Vanadium, Va |
0.10 |
Physical Properties
The physical properties of aluminium / aluminum 2319 alloy are outlined in the following table.
Properties |
Metric |
Imperial |
Density |
2.84 g/cm³ |
0.102 lb/in³ |
Melting point |
543 - 643 °C |
1009-1189°F |
Mechanical Properties
The mechanical properties of aluminium / aluminum 2319 alloy are tabulated below.
Properties |
Metric |
Imperial |
Poisson’s ratio |
0.33 |
0.33 |
Elastic modulus |
70-80 GPa |
10152-11603 ksi |

Applications
Aluminium / aluminum 2319 alloy is chiefly used as welding filler wire for high strength structural aircraft and truck body applications.
